This month, we continue our focus on listening, with the “listening with courage” challenge.
I invite you to listen with courage--because, listening takes courage.
The courage to:
delay your interest, in service to the speaker
“not know” what will transpire
change or suspend your position, if required
(What would you add to this list?)
Listening with courage is an act of advocacy--for ourselves, our clients, and our communities. To be a part of change in our lives and in the lives of those we serve, listening is one of the most powerful and basic acts available for us to embrace.
Yes, therapists are skilled listeners. Likely, more skilled than most. However, we, too, encounter barriers to fully listening.
Through this month’s challenge, you’ll reflect on the call to listen with courage, and learn how to listen "loudly."
